  • 5 Reasons Why You Should Consider Teeth Whitening

    In addition to being a sign of excellent dental health, a radiant white smile can increase self-esteem and make a lasting impression. Teeth whitening could be the answer for you if you’ve been thinking about ways to improve your smile. Here, we’ll go over five strong arguments for thinking about teeth whitening, along with how cosmetic dentistry in Miami, FL, can drastically improve your appearance and self-esteem.

    Boost in Self-Confidence:

    White teeth are typically linked to a more confident grin and can make a big difference. Teeth discoloration or staining can make people feel self-conscious and inhibit their ability to smile. Treatments for teeth whitening can dramatically brighten your smile and give you the self-assurance to show off your brilliant whites without hesitation.

    Enhanced Professional Image:

    A lively and bright grin can provide a good first impression in personal and professional settings. A whiter grin can help you project a polished and professional image whether you’re meeting new people, giving a presentation, or attending a job interview. It’s an investment in your own identity that can pay off and have a beneficial influence.

    Rejuvenation of Youthful Appearance:

    Our teeth’s natural color may fade as we become older and stains may build up. Whiter teeth can make you look younger and more lively, almost like a time machine. A brighter smile can be a straightforward yet powerful technique to revitalize your appearance and give off an image that is more lively and vibrant.

    Removal of Stains and Discoloration:

    Stains and discolorations on teeth can be caused due to external factors, including drinking coffee, tea, red wine, and certain meals. Another big offender is smoking. Teeth whitening procedures specifically target these stains, removing the discoloration and exposing a whiter, brighter enamel. It’s an easy and effective method to remove external stains and improve the overall look of your teeth.

    Customized and Controlled Brightening:

    Procedures for teeth whitening are adaptable and can be customized to match personal tastes. A controlled and personalized brightening smile can be achieved with professional teeth whitening, regardless of your preference for a more dramatic or subtle transformation. Your dentist can collaborate with you to reach the desired level of whiteness about your tastes and goals.   • How Long Do Dental Fillings Last?

    Dental fillings or tooth fillings in Miami, FL, are the unsung heroes in the complex web of oral health, protecting against the indomitable forces of decay. Navigating the route to a strong and durable smile requires an understanding of dental fillings, including what they are, how they work, and how long they last.

    What Are Dental Fillings?

    Teeth damaged by decay can be restored with dental fillings, which are restorative materials. When a cavity forms, a dentist will extract the decayed part of the tooth and fill the space with materials that will help the tooth regain its structural integrity. In addition to stopping the spread of decay, fillings shield the damaged tooth from additional harm.

    How Long Do Dental Fillings Last?

    Several factors affect how long dental fillings last. Oral hygiene procedures, individual habits, the kind of filling material used, and the size and location of the filling all matter. In general, dental fillings can endure five to fifteen years if maintained and cared for properly.

    Types of Dental Fillings:

    Cast Gold Filling:

    Gold fillings are a conventional alternative that can tolerate strong chewing forces because of their reputation for durability. Although their lifetime is admirable, they are less common in places of the mouth where they are visible due to their noticeable look.

    Silver Fillings:

    For many years, amalgam, a compound of silver, tin, copper, and mercury, has been used extensively in dentistry. Although silver fillings are strong and reasonably priced, their silver hue may be apparent, detracting from their aesthetic appeal.

    Tooth-Colored or Composite Fillings:

    Composite fillings are tooth-colored and have a more natural appearance since they are composed of a combination of plastic and tiny glass particles. They provide adaptability in treating different dental conditions since they bond directly to the tooth.

    Ceramic Fillings:

    Fillings made of ceramic or porcelain are long-lasting and visually beautiful. They are a common option for visible parts of the mouth since they are stain-resistant and frequently utilized for front teeth.

    Temporary Fillings:

    As a temporary fix, temporary fillings are frequently utilized in urgent cases or while a permanent filling is being prepared. They are not meant for long-term usage and offer temporary protection.
    When Should Fillings Be Replaced?

    Wear, deterioration around the filling, or structural changes in the tooth can all lead to the need for a replacement filling. Frequent dental examinations are necessary to track the health of fillings and spot any early warning indicators of deterioration.

    How To Make Dental Fillings Last Longer:

    Maintain Good Oral Hygiene:

    Cleaning your teeth twice a day, flossing once a day, and using an antiseptic mouthwash will help keep dental fillings intact and prevent decay.

    Regular Dental Check-ups:

    Dentists can monitor the state of fillings, identify problems early, and treat them quickly with routine dental appointments.

    Avoid Harmful Habits:

    Dental fillings can last longer and sustain less damage if bad behaviors like grinding your teeth and sucking on harsh things are avoided.
